deterministic finite automata string search


Definition: A string matching algorithm which builds a deterministic finite state machine to recognize the search string. The machine is then run at each location in turn. If the machine accepts, that is a match.

description and animation (C), (C) which uses a finite automaton structure (C) and builds a recognizer (C)
